#95299b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95299b is composed of 58.4% red, 16.1%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 296.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 38.4%. #95299b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#2b0037.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#95299b color description : Dark magenta.

#95299b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95299b has RGB values of R:149, G:41,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 9775515.

Shades and Tints of #95299b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#95299b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665e66 is the less saturated color, while #b703c1 is the most saturated one.
